All grid systems have spacing or “gutters†around columns. In the case of Bootstrap, the gutter is created using padding of 15px around each column. The effective
gutter displayed between neighboring columns in 30px. The outer columns (leftmost & rightmost) need to have 1/2 of the gutter (15px) on the outside to keep spacing
consistent.
The relationship between .container and .row is made complete with columns (col-*). Each row is divided horizontally using Bootstrap’s column classes col-*.
